Common Water Line Repair Problems

Denver's unique climate and soil conditions create specific challenges for water line systems. The dry Colorado climate causes soil to shift and contract, putting stress on underground water lines throughout neighborhoods like Wash Park, Cheesman Park, and Capitol Hill. Tree roots are another major culprit, especially in Denver's older residential areas where mature trees have had decades to grow and infiltrate pipes. Corrosion is particularly common in Denver homes built before the 1970s, where galvanized steel pipes deteriorate over time and develop leaks or reduced water pressure. Freezing temperatures during Denver winters can also cause pipes to crack or burst, particularly if lines aren't properly insulated. Signs you might need water line repair include unusually high water bills, wet spots in your yard, low water pressure throughout your home, or discolored water coming from your taps. Water Line Repair Systems and Materials

Modern water line repair has evolved significantly from the old galvanized steel and cast iron methods that plague many older Denver homes. Today, we primarily work with copper, PEX (cross-linked polyethylene), and PVC piping, each offering distinct advantages depending on your specific situation. Copper remains the gold standard for water line longevity and reliability, offering excellent corrosion resistance and a lifespan of 50+ years. PEX has become increasingly popular for water line repairs because it's flexible, less prone to freezing issues, resists corrosion, and can be installed with minimal excavation in many cases.
